Mr. Speaker, as vice chair of the Agriculture Committee and a conferee, I rise in strong support of this rule and the underlying bill, the farm bill of 2018. Over the past 3 years, the House and Senate Agriculture Committees comprehensively reviewed the 2014 farm bill through a variety of hearings to gain feedback from hundreds of farmers, ranchers, landowners, and stakeholders. This conference report is the final product of this process and months of bipartisan, bicameral compromise. While there are many important provisions within the bill to highlight, at its core, the farm bill is about supporting American agriculture and access to food. It is about supporting our domestic food supply and our ability to feed, clothe, and provide energy and fiber for all Americans. One portion of this bill I am particularly pleased with is the dairy reforms contained in title 1. These reforms build on the positive changes made to the dairy margin insurance program in this year's bipartisan budget agreement. Our dairy farmers have continued to face difficult times over the past decade, and I am hopeful that the 2018 farm bill will help to provide some stability in this sector.
